55 Blair road house is a renovation and restoration of a traditional art deco style shop house. The designer perfectly convert this house into ultra modern style with offers an exciting natural light with open plan living which is unusual to this types of terrace house. Designed by Ong ong, especially brings a balance between nature and contemporary living. The house has a beautiful Art Deco style terrace and an awesome swimming pool. On the center of the house it has a modern spiral staircase that creates a vocal point of this room, for more detail about this house you can download the floorplan and section here.
Architect : Ong ong | Photos by : Derek Swalwell

Villa Astrid is a beautiful building on West Swedish Landscape. Designed by Wingardhs design studio this villa was dictated by the local building code, which stipulates a 3.5-metre eaves height and a roof pitch between 14 and 27 degrees. The two storey villa with exotic interior design, the first floor contains the bedrooms and other private space, and the second floor has an open-plan kitchen, a separate dining room and a large lounge, for outdoor relaxing it has an outdoor lounge with outdoor fireplace. The exterior was made from concrete, insulated with foamglass and the clad with metal sheeting. . The glazed sections resemble holes cut out of solid copper armour plating. The structure is very robust. Concrete roof beams insulated with foam glass repose on the walls of lightweight concrete, giving a totally impervious structure beneath the skin of patinated copper. Copper ions are neutralised by crushed limestone round the foundation.

Jose Orrego the Peruvian architect is the designer of this stunning beach house located on Palabritas Beach in Lima, Peru. The house especially designed to offers amazing beach views, the exterior is so beautiful with modern curves that remind of the Brazilian architecture of the sixties. Both of exterior and interior was dominated in white color and combined with red accent, its a perfect combination. The exterior was designed as a white elevated box, exposed from its front side. One of the sides has a concrete lattice based on a contemporary composition with perforations that allow the interior to have a transparency without losing its intimacy. The dining and living room are placed so that they can be integrate with the terrace by sliding the glass doors. An interior patio was developed on a lower level where the bedrooms and family room conjoin so that an intimate zone for these rooms are created. The main bedroom is located on the first level and was designed so that it had a view towards the ocean. As a whole the house created a contrast of red color over white surfaces, in a way that the spaces give an appearance of amplitude. From the inside of the living room, the architecture offers a frame that shows the landscape of the beach, the island and the sunset.
